Balance

Wednesday, August 3rd, 2005 by joel

There is this general concept in eastern countries that the universe exists as a delicate balance between light and dark. It is necessary (they say) to maintain this balance. If the universe shifts out of balance, then things go wacky, spirits roam wrestles, dragons are displeased, ancestors get ticked… you know, that stuff.
So, whereas a ‘Western’ story would involve evil arising, beating down on folks for a while, and then good triumphing over the evil; an ‘Eastern’ tale involves a misbalanced where one side or the other becomes too powerful, and then, usually through some heroics, balance is restored.
This concept, that we must achieve a state of harmonic balance and then just sort of exist at this state, seems to be what has driven eastern culture. Only now are they beginning to get into the swing of western thought where it’s all-or-nothing, win-at-all-costs sort of stuff. Its clear that even THEY did not entirely embrace this idea of drifting along at a state of unchanging harmony, or their fiction would not involve heroics and constant shifts in the balance.
It is a tempting line of reasoning for a couch potato lifestyle, though. Balance is achieved by sitting in front of the TV pushing buttons on my game controller. Unbalance happens when a bigger TV or a better game or gaming system comes out. My harmony is challenged by such things as ‘rent’ and a ‘job.’
Yeah. This doesn’t work for Western culture at all.
